Transaction 667aa00bf31fb4944631830ebdbcbc02dc834557ff4c88becc6ac12d5a94780a
1 Input
1 Output
-
667aa00bf31fb4944631830ebdbcbc02dc834557ff4c88becc6ac12d5a94780a:0
- value
- 19996519
- script pubkey
- OP_0 OP_PUSHBYTES_20 6a76309b7a39b36a64c220252002d313010a7022
- address
- bc1qdfmrpxm68xek5exzyqjjqqknzvqs5upz3w8nee